  • Desafios metodologicos da pesquisa com adolescentes e jovens de comunidades perifericas: reflexoes a partir de um estudo em cinco capitais brasileiras #MMPMID41337626
  • Knauth DR; Monteiro S; Fonseca VDN; Neves ALMD; Magno L; Leal AF; Barbosa RM
  • Cien Saude Colet 2025[Nov]; 30 (11): e12402025 PMID41337626show ga
  • This article aims to discuss the methodological challenges and strategies involved in conducting research with adolescents and young people living in marginalized communities in large urban centers. The experiences and data presented are drawn from a study conducted in peripheral communities of five Brazilian capital cities: Porto Alegre, Sao Paulo, Rio de Janeiro, Salvador, and Manaus. The research employed a qualitative approach. Data were generated through observations in the social spaces frequented by adolescents and young people in each community, semi-structured interviews, and focus groups. The main methodological challenges encountered included: determining the appropriate age range for participants; ethically including individuals under the age of 18; identifying and reaching adolescents and youth; engaging local mediators to access participants; and ensuring data quality. The methodological challenges identified in this study provide valuable insights into the lived realities of young people in marginalized communities in major Brazilian cities. Beyond presenting research strategies, we argue that both the difficulties encountered and the successful strategies adopted offer a deeper understanding of today's youth.
